Setting the Day/Night Control
The table below explains the options on the DAY/NIGHT SETUP menu.
Restoring Settings
On the main MENU, select RESTORE DEFAULTS, then YES followed by
ENTER (middle button). This reloads the factory default camera settings.
Caution This action replaces all custom settings.
>D/N CONTROL Select either:
<AUTO> (default), or
<OFF> camera stays in color mode.
This setting is dependent on the AGC setting. (See “>AGC” on
page 34)
>NIGHT MODE The NIGHT MODE screen determines whether monochrome (B/W)
or color is present in the video. Options are:
<B/W> suppresses all color, including color burst, present in the
video.
<B/W + CLR> (default) = B/W with color burst
<COLOR> the camera never switches to B/W in night mode.
